How much does a Suntalk Llc Logistics make?

As of May 2025, the average annual salary for a Logistics at Suntalk Llc is $43,025, which translates to approximately $21 per hour. Salaries for Logistics at Suntalk Llc typically range from $39,095 to $47,165,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. SunTalk LLC is the leading Wide Area Coverage provider in Southeast Florida. We are a Motorola Solutions Channel Partner offering state-of-the-art Motorola Connect Plus all-digital two way radio communication solutions. Our coverage area, unlimited talk features, and seamless connectivity enable your business to stay connected and stay productive when it matters most. SunTalk LLC has service and support personnel to insure your critical communications network performs at the optimum level. SunTalks's service personnel are equipped with the latest diagnostic equipment and backed by Motorola factory support team providing the highest quality service and repair for today's sophisticated wireless systems.

  1. Logistics: In a general business sense, logistics is the management of the flow of things between the point of origin and the point of consumption to meet the requirements of customers or corporations.
  2. Transportation: Refers to the mode of travel used to get from home to work most frequently. The transportation are bus, train, aeroplane, ship, car, etc while the mode of transportation refers to road, air, sea/ocean, etc.
  3. Customer Service: Customer service is the provision of service to customers before, during and after a purchase. The perception of success of such interactions is dependent on employees "who can adjust themselves to the personality of the guest". Customer service concerns the priority an organization assigns to customer service relative to components such as product innovation and pricing. In this sense, an organization that values good customer service may spend more money in training employees than the average organization or may proactively interview customers for feedback. From the point of view of an overall sales process engineering effort, customer service plays an important role in an organization's ability to generate income and revenue. From that perspective, customer service should be included as part of an overall approach to systematic improvement. One good customer service experience can change the entire perception a customer holds towards the organization.
  4. Supply chain: A supply chain encompasses everything from the delivery of source materials from the supplier to the manufacturer through to its eventual delivery to the end user.
  5. Microsoft Office: Microsoft Office is a suite of desktop productivity applications that is designed by Microsoft for business use. You can create documents containing text and images, work with data in spreadsheets and databases, create presentations and posters.
